What are the potential risks and drawbacks of relying solely on RSI overbought and oversold indicators for cryptocurrency trading?

- Neymar MullerSep 09, 2022 · 3 years agoRelying solely on RSI overbought and oversold indicators for cryptocurrency trading can have several potential risks and drawbacks. Firstly, these indicators are based on historical price data and may not accurately reflect the current market conditions. This can lead to false signals and incorrect trading decisions. Additionally, RSI indicators are only one piece of the puzzle and should not be the sole basis for making trading decisions. It is important to consider other technical indicators, fundamental analysis, and market sentiment before making any trades. Lastly, overreliance on RSI indicators can lead to emotional trading and herd mentality, where traders may buy or sell based solely on the indicator without considering other factors. This can result in losses and missed opportunities in the market.

- SarFarMay 01, 2021 · 4 years agoRelying solely on RSI overbought and oversold indicators for cryptocurrency trading may not always yield accurate results. While these indicators can provide insights into potential market reversals, they are not foolproof and should be used in conjunction with other analysis techniques. It is important to consider the overall market trend, volume, and other technical indicators to confirm the signals provided by RSI. Additionally, market conditions can change rapidly, and relying solely on RSI indicators may result in missed opportunities or delayed reactions to market movements. Traders should also be aware of the limitations of RSI indicators, such as the tendency to generate false signals in ranging markets. By diversifying analysis techniques and considering multiple factors, traders can make more informed decisions and reduce the risks associated with relying solely on RSI indicators.
